Not sure i see the argument for Matthews to be worth substantially more than MacKinnon, whose 8 x $12.6m deal starts this year. Matthews has the advantage on the regular season nerdies (though MacKinnon is still awesome there as well), but MacKinnon has a big advantage in scoring stats. And in the playoffs i'd wager MacKinnon beats him on both and proved he can lead a team to a cup.

I also see more motivation for MacKinnon to max out this deal, given how little he made on his previous deal, and given that he already won a cup.

Matthews has made double what MacKinnon did on his pre-UFA deal, and has zero playoffs success - much more incentive for Matthews to not max out than there was for MacKinnon.
